Fractography of Fish-eye Cracks in Nitride Steel Specimens: Assessment of Residual Fatigue Life

Original Abstract
An assessment of the residual fatigue life of plasma-nitrided high-strength low-alloy steel specimens has been performed. The study combines fractographical observation of the local striations field found in the centre of the fish-eye crack of the specimen subjected to combined bending-torsion loading with the linear elastic fracture mechanics modelling of the fatigue crack growth. The results suggest that the propagation stage constitutes only a minor part of the total fatigue life, the major part of which is spent on the crack initiation. This conclusion is consistent with the high- and ultra-high-cycle behaviour of specimens without any surface hardening layer.
